Background Information:

The PathHunter® HEK 293 CD27 NF-kB Signaling Pathway Reporter Cell Line is a stable, engineered cell line that overexpresses CD27. It can be used in studying drug candidates (small molecules or biologics) affecting the NF-kB pathway. This cell line enables assessment of NF-kB pathway stimulation based on changes in the expression of a NF-Kb response element-driven reporter protein. This product uses EFC technology. The included cell line expresses PL-tagged reporter protein under the control of a NF-KB pathway-inducible transcriptional response element. Pathway activation induces expression of the PL-tagged protein, allowing detection of EFC signal upon addition of EA-containing detection reagent.
This stable engineered cell line is provided as two vials of cryopreserved cells.
